Dino Geek essaye de t'aider

Comment installer et configurer un environnement LAMP (Linux Apache MySQL PHP) sur un VPS ?


Installer un environnement LAMP sur un serveur VPS est relativement simple et concerne généralement une série d’étapes d’installation de chaque composant: Linux, Apache, MySQL et PHP. Voici un guide générique pour l’installation, qui peut varier en fonction de votre distribution Linux spécifique.

Un pré requis est de disposer d’un accès root sur votre machine.

1. Vérifiez votre distribution Linux : Commencez par vérifier votre version de distribution Linux avec la commande suivante : `lsb_release -a`

1. Mettez à jour votre système : Avant de commencer, il est recommandé de mettre à jour votre système à l’aide de la commande suivante : `sudo apt-get update && sudo apt-get upgrade -y`

1. Installation d’Apache : Installez le serveur web Apache avec la commande suivante : `sudo apt-get install apache2 -y` Après avoir installé Apache, ouvrez une page Web et accédez à votre adresse IP de serveur. Si Apache est installé correctement, vous devriez voir une page Apache par défaut.

1. Installation de MySQL : Vous pouvez installer MySQL en utilisant la commande suivante : `sudo apt-get install mysql-server -y` Après l’installation, sécurisez votre installation MySQL en utilisant la commande suivante : `sudo mysql_secure_installation`

1. Installation de PHP : Vous pouvez installer PHP et certains modules supplémentaires avec la commande suivante : `sudo apt-get install php libapache2-mod-php php-mcrypt php-mysql -y` Pour vérifier si PHP est installé correctement, créez un simple script PHP dans le dossier /var/www/html/. `sudo nano /var/www/html/info.php` Ajoutez le code suivant : `` Sauvegardez et fermez le fichier. Naviguez ensuite vers http://your_server_IP/info.php. Vous devriez voir une page affichant des informations sur votre installation PHP.

Félicitations ! Vous avez installé un environnement LAMP sur votre serveur VPS.


Générez simplement des articles pour optimiser votre SEO
Générez simplement des articles pour optimiser votre SEO





DinoGeek propose des articles simples sur des technologies complexes

Vous souhaitez être cité dans cet article ? Rien de plus simple, contactez-nous à dino@eiki.fr

CSS | NodeJS | DNS | DMARC | MAPI | NNTP | htaccess | PHP | HTTPS | Drupal | WEB3 | LLM | Wordpress | TLD | Nom de Domaine | IMAP | TCP | NFT | MariaDB | FTP | Zigbee | NMAP | SNMP | SEO | E-Mail | LXC | HTTP | MangoDB | SFTP | RAG | SSH | HTML | ChatGPT API | OSPF | JavaScript | Docker | OpenVZ | ChatGPT | VPS | ZIMBRA | SPF | UDP | Joomla | IPV6 | BGP | Django | Reactjs | DKIM | VMWare | RSYNC | Python | TFTP | Webdav | FAAS | Apache | IPV4 | LDAP | POP3 | SMTP

| Whispers of love (API) | Déclaration d'Amour |






Mentions Légales / Conditions Générales d'Utilisation